Angelo Ronald Pro – Monessen

By obits

 

Angelo Ronald Pro, 89, of Monessen, passed away on Monday, Dec. 5, 2022, at his home. He was born in Pittsburgh, on April 22, 1933, son of the late Giovan-ni and Mary DiBartolo Pro. Angelo was a member of Epiphany of Our Lord Roman Catholic Church, American Legion Post 28 and the former Mon Valley Association of Retired Steelworkers (MARS). He worked for American Chain and Cable, Page Division, Wheeling-Pittsburgh Steel’s Allenport plant and Mon Valley Hospital in the dietary department. He was a veteran of the Korean War, having served with the U.S. Air Force from 1951-53. Angelo is survived by his wife of 67 years, Olivia A. Perozzi Pro; his son, Lawrence (Aimee) Pro of Monessen; two grandchildren, Angela (Mark) Labozzetta and Eric (Cristal) Pro; three great-grandchildren, Leona, Hadlee and Jaxon; and numerous nieces and nephews. In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by two sons, Gregory Pro and David Pro; two brothers, John Pro and Richard Pro; and by a sister, Joanne Pro.
